Christian Jankowski’s The Hunt (1992/1997), single-channel video, 1 minute 11 seconds
For this piece, the German artist ate only what he could shoot an arrow into at grocery stores. When I saw the video in Boston recently, a group of older women also happened to be watching it. One of them immediately said, with some concern, “What did he do for juice??”
